  • Dunster village - 13th century castle and Yarn Market (1609) where cloth was sold.

  • Dunkery Beacon - highest point on Exmoor (1,700ft).

  • Tarr Steps - ancient 'clapper bridge' for pack horses carrying wool to Dunster.

  • Oare's church - setting for Lorna Doone (1869).

  • Minehead - built around a pretty quay, with a steam railway running to Bishops Lydeard.

  • Simonsbath - a good starting point for walkers, Exmoor pony territory.
